Investigating the roles and challenges of female extension workers: a systematic review

As the demographics of farming communities change and innovations evolve, the role of female extension workers becomes more critical, especially in reaching out to women farmers who are often primary agricultural laborers in rural households and supporting them to adopt new practices and technologies. This study investigates how the roles and challenges of female extension workers are represented in the literature and what assumptions and implications underpin these representations.
